Southern-Style Honey Butter Cornbread Poppers

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Course Appetizer, Dessert, Side Dish
Cuisine American
Keyword Southern-Style Honey Butter Cornbread Poppers
Servings 4
Bite‑sized cornbread poppers with sweet corn, bell pepper, and cheddar, drizzled with honey butter. Perfect for brunch or snacking!

Ingredients

Dry Ingredients

  • 1 cup cornmeal
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• ¼ cup granulated sugar
  • 1 tablespoon ba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on salt

Wet Ingredients

  • 1 cup buttermilk
  • 2 large eggs
  • ¼ cup melted unsalted butter

Add-Ins

  • 1 cup sweet corn kernels fresh or frozen
  • ½ cup diced red bell pepper
  • ½ cup shredded cheddar cheese sharp or mild

Honey Butter

  • ¼ cup honey for drizzling
  • ¼ cup unsalted butter softened

Garnish

  • Fresh parsley or cilantro

Instructions

Preheat & Prepare

  •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Lightly grease a mini muffin tin or popper pan.

Mix Dry Ingredients

  • Whisk together cornmeal, fl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t in a large bowl.

Combine Wet Ingredients

  • In another bowl, beat together buttermilk, eggs, and melted butter.

Blend Wet & Dry Mixtures

  • Add the wet mixture to the dry ingredients, stirring until just combined.

Fold in Add-Ins

  • Gently fold in corn kernels, diced red bell pepper, and shredded cheddar.

Fill & Bake

  • Spoon batter into the prepared tin, filling each cup about two-thirds full. Bake for 15–18 minutes, or until golden and a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.

Prepare Honey Butter

  • While poppers bake, combine softened butter and honey until smooth.

Cool & Serve

  • Let poppers cool slightly before removing. Drizzle with honey butter and garnish with parsley or cilantro.
